Hello,

This is a Body Position Sensor for the HID Headlights, and it is not supposed to look like that.

It appears that the arm that attaches to the sensor itself jumped out of its sector, which likely happened during one of the suspension repairs, when the wheel was lowered below a certain point. To correct this, you will have to unbolt the link between the sensor and the suspension, and put the sensor arm back to the correct orientation, here is a thread that shows the correct position for it.

I thought it was going to take me 30min - 1 hour to fix this. But holy moly, it took less than a minute (minus jacking up the car). Just loosen the lower nut (10mm) and then push the elbow joint away, and then tighten the nut again.
